The above article, written by Vassilis Psyrras (senior
associate) and Ioannis Sidiropoulos (associate), has been published
on the website of the Phileleftheros newspaper. The article deals
with the corporate directors' options in the event of deadlock
at the corporate General Meeting. In particular, the authors
present the possible course of action when shareholders cannot
reach a decision on the approval of the Financial Statements and
the reappointment of auditors. They also include an analysis of the
law's provisions and case law for potential court involvement
in a de facto deadlock in the General Meeting.
